sigc++-2.0.dll 丢失问题通常源于缺少必要的运行库文件。解决方法取决于具体情况,但核心在于找到并正确安装这个文件。
我曾经在协助一位朋友安装一款老旧的图像处理软件时,就遇到了这个问题。软件启动时提示sigc-2.0.dll缺失,导致无法运行。当时我尝试了几个方法,最终才找到有效的解决途径。
直接安装缺失的DLL文件: 这看起来是最简单的办法,但风险也最大。从非官方渠道下载DLL文件可能引入恶意软件或病毒。我建议你只从可信赖的软件发行商或大型软件下载网站获取,并仔细核实文件完整性和来源。下载后,将文件复制到系统提示缺少该文件的目录,通常是软件安装目录或系统目录下的System32文件夹(注意:64位系统可能需要复制到SysWOW64文件夹)。然而,直接替换DLL文件有时并不能解决问题,因为版本不兼容或文件损坏可能会导致新的错误。
重新安装软件: 如果直接替换DLL文件无效,重新安装软件可能是更稳妥的选择。这会确保所有必要的运行库文件都被正确安装。在重新安装前,建议先彻底卸载原软件,清除所有残留文件和注册表项,以避免冲突。我曾经遇到过一个案例,软件卸载不干净,导致重新安装后仍然出现同样的问题。彻底清除残留文件,解决了我朋友的困扰。
更新或修复系统文件: 系统文件损坏也可能导致DLL文件丢失。你可以尝试运行系统文件检查器(SFC)来扫描并修复损坏的系统文件。在命令提示符(以管理员身份运行)中输入sfc /scannow,并等待扫描完成。这个过程可能需要一些时间。 如果SFC无法解决问题,考虑使用系统修复工具或重新安装操作系统,这通常是最后的手段,但能有效解决底层系统问题。
寻找软件依赖的运行库: 某些软件依赖特定的运行库,例如Visual C++ Redistributable。sigc++库通常与这些运行库相关联。检查软件的系统需求或安装文档,看看它是否需要特定的运行库。下载并安装这些运行库,有时就能解决DLL丢失的问题。我记得有一次,就是因为缺少一个特定的Visual C++运行库导致一个游戏无法运行,安装后问题便迎刃而解。
总而言之,解决sigc-2.0.dll丢失问题需要谨慎操作,并根据具体情况选择合适的解决方法。优先选择安全可靠的方法,避免下载不明来源的文件。如果以上方法都无效,建议寻求专业人士的帮助。
路由网(www.lu-you.com)您可以查阅其它相关文章!